Schools in Berkeley NSW

There are 30 schools near Berkeley — 21 government, 3 Catholic, and 6 independent. Average ICSEA score is 974 (national average: 1000). Total enrolments: 9,759 students.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many schools are in Berkeley NSW?

There are 30 schools near Berkeley — 21 government (public), 3 Catholic, and 6 independent schools.

What is the average ICSEA score for schools in Berkeley?

The average ICSEA score for schools near Berkeley is 974. The national average is 1000. ICSEA (Index of Community Socio-Educational Advantage) measures the educational advantages students bring to their studies.
